The slush funds known as economic development programs not only lavish 7 billion in New York state tax dollars each year, not only lavish these special perks to a mere 4% of businesses, they do so in a secretive fashion that provide no accountability to assure the recipients actually produce the number of jobs they promise. Over a quarter of projects receiving "economic development" funds were not obligated to promise to create or retain a single job.
To the extent that the data could be analyzed, only 13% produced the number of jobs proposed while 40% either didn't create a single job or actually lost jobs.
